ROY JOSEPH STEVENS

STEVENS, ROY JOSEPH - The death of Roy Joseph Stevens, of East Saint John, loving husband of Olive Stevens, occurred peacefully at his residence on Tuesday April 25, 2006. Born 1929 in Montreal, Quebec he was the son of the late Roy and Mary (Cotton) Stevens. Roy was a loving family man and a hard worker. He was a Painter for the Saint John Dry dock retiring in 1995 after 45 years. He was also a member of Local # 3 Marine Shipbuilders of Canada. He is survived by two sons Brian (Lynn) of Gondola Point and Carl (Lucy) of Saint John; four daughters Mary Creamer (Dwight) of Rothesay, Dianne LeBlanc (David) of Fredericton Jct., Debbie Cole (Leo Hasselman) of Hampton and Cindy Barry (John) of Saint John; 14 grandchildren; seven great grandchildren; two brothers Leonard (Marie) and Melvin (Jean) both of Saint John; three sisters Florence Jukes of Ontario, Patricia Carpenter (Clarence) and Gail Chatterton both of Saint John; several cousins, nieces and nephews. Besides his parents he was predeceased by brothers Clifford, Stewart, Gerald and Kenneth and infant granddaughter Sarah Stevens. Resting at Fundy Funeral Home, 230 Westmorland Road, Saint John, (646-2424) with visitations on Wednesday from 2-4 and 7-9 p.m. A Mass of Christian Burial will be celebrated from Stella Maris Church on Thursday April 27, 2006 at 12 noon. Following cremation interment will take place in Ocean View Memorial Gardens Cemetery at a later date.
